Here’s my latest - the awesome Aoshima MGB.  I kept it 95% box stock, but added a couple of details to the interior and cut the hood open in case I want to add an engine at some point down the road.

This kit was a great palette cleanser after a string of more stressful builds. The only tricky part was the ride height - it needs to be lowered significantly to look right. In the rear I had to cut away the top of the wheel housing just to get the wheels to fit. In the front, I took it down by 6-7 mm and it still looks a bit high. That said, I really enjoyed this kit and would definitely buy another one.

Paint is MCW butternut on the exterior cleared with Mr Super Clear gloss. The interior is a custom mix of Tamiya LP paints for the leather and semi gloss black for the dash. Wheels and bumpers are kit chrome hit with tamiya smoke and panel washes. Trim and windshield are bare metal foil. The rest of the chrome bits are Alclad. I added a little Union Jack badge on the passenger side because the 1:1 I used for inspiration had one. It also had the brown leather interior kit which I thought looked cool with the yellow (and I didn’t feel like making another black interior!).

thanks fellas! the super clear gloss has been a godsend.  i was using ts-13 on everything and was worried when i made the switch to the airbrush, but i may like this clear coat even better.  goes down so smoothly with a little leveling thinner. the lp paints are awesome too - i even added some of the tamiya acrylic to the mix and it blended right in without issue.
